Output 37e85e8996a675a04eae050715fddf9df7abaaaae5224d2a567cdd4f3fab7130:1

value
17926987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5024abb3125949aedb10eb34d013672076745f61 OP_EQUAL
address
38zmupEVcNLkhyhVGb2v4rJ56r4zb1tsqn
transaction
37e85e8996a675a04eae050715fddf9df7abaaaae5224d2a567cdd4f3fab7130
spent
true